Concrete Replica

The creature stood tall and straight like a guardian. From what he could see, it wasn't the strongest in that Abyss but it seemed to be the strongest one that Jin Woo currently had access to.

"What are those?" Gunhee asked surprisely calm unlike the many in the room.

Even as he spoke more and more of these shadowy soul creatures arose from the ground. Even high-level summoners had problems keeping two or three summons and he could do about fifty without problems.

"My summons, I call them Shadows" Jin Woo explained with a smile.

Silence reigned throughout the room as they all examined and compared themselves to the creatures he just summoned. They were S-ranks at the lowest but even so, these creatures were on par with them.

Fighting Jin Woo would mean fighting against god knows how many S-ranks he could summon. Everyone watched with such a similar thought in mind but Steve, on the other hand, continued to stare deeper into the abyss.

He didn't want to believe that Jin Woo was one of those Monarchs… Creating Judy and studying the Gate had made him come to the conclusion that there were many more like Baran out there.

Of course, he couldn't state their alignment hence why he had yet to attack Jin Woo but at the same time, looking at the young boy before him, he could also tell fully well that he had no idea what his power was.

This was the burden of knowledge, the Ignorant really had no idea how blissful it was.

"Impressive," Gunhee said after a while.

"Do they happen to have any other types of abilities?" Henry asked 

"That one can use magic" Jin Woo answered as he pointed towards a massive shadow.

Looking at it carefully, the creature looked like some form of Orc Shaman. No, it was once an Orc Shaman and a really powerful one at that…. The amount of soul energy and mana, Steve could feel from it put it on par with the S-ranks here but considering how necromancy works… it may have been of a lesser rank before.

"That's a very versatile power, you are basically a true one-man army…. Can you like transfer your consciousness from one of them to another to like to pass on messages or something?" Steve asked curiously.

He decided to let it all be, if Jin Woo truly was one of the Monarchs then he would beat him as well just as he had done to Baran. It would not be easy but nothing good ever comes easily.

"Okay thank you, sir, Mr Grant, what about you?" the young man called out after writing down some things… he seemed a little too calm for someone who just saw a twenty-year-old summon ten S-ranks.

"Sure," Steve said before gently stumping on the ground.

As soon as he did so, everyone saw a small portion of the earth rumpled up, seeing this, the group immediately gave way as they tried to avoid whatever it was that was coming out.

The rumpled earth grew larger and larger, it was as though it wasn't solid concrete anymore but some form of mud or something. From this 'mud' they all saw some beings rise. 

It was them.

"What?" 

Steve heard several screams of shock as a smile formed on his face, before him now stood about seven people. He had created an exact copy of everyone in the room.
